About Zerowood

Story brief

Unidentified planets appear,Causing countless human deaths and injuries,A young man save his parents,He uses special power to fight aliens。

Game content

《Zerowood》It's a 2D action game,Some game levels has a fighting system,You can enter the buttons in order show your skills,It's like a fighting game。But,Each game level is different。You can control our hero to fight,And control the alien mech warrior to fight。This game has bicycle、skateboard、air battle too。This is a special action game。

Play this game。You can ride a bike fast to avoid traffic,On the truck chop energy ball and fight alien spiders。Sit in meditation,Use soul power fighting the alien mech warrior。And summon soul sword cover you。Skateboard game levels,You can do a kickflip attack excavator。Yes! Very crazy!

Not recommended Oct 11, 2022
Lucky me gets the dubious honour of writing the first review for Zerowood. Zerowood is a very poorly made arcade/endless runner with a UFO invasion theme. Gameplay consists of riding a bike endlessly to the left, avoiding or jumping on cars, avoiding trucks etc while the UFOs fly overhead and cause more problems. Overall, a very shallow gaming experience that makes mobile apps like Angry Birds look deep and sophisticated. Valve says we're supposed to write something we "like" about games when we write a review, so... uh... this is sincerely made and doesn't seem to be an asset flip. That's unfortunately where the good stuff runs out. There's only partial English translation for the game, many elements of the UI aren't in English, but that's ok. It turns out, the language of bad games is universal. From a technical perspective, the game doesn't meet basic minimum requirements that most PC gamers expect as standard. A choice was made to use obsolete, decades old retro pixel "art" as a substitute for contemporary PC graphics. Not recommended Dec 18, 2022
Before I start my review of this Travesty let me say that if you decide to try this game make sure your Windows Display settings are set to 60FPS , because 240 is like watching roaches speed across your screen ....good luck .... This is a great disappointment. The opening video looks awesome!! then the ship comes out and I like the way this game looks. THEN IT ALL GOES DOWNHILL. You are on a Bike, you ride your bike in heavy traffic and jump over or on top of other vehicles. That's about it . Honestly ive enjoyed watching paint dry and reruns of the TV Show ALF (in French), more than playing this game. If Wasting your money and time on this tragedy turns you on, then go for it .. P.S. I don't know what that video is that shows the supposed gameplay , but uh , you are on a bike, in traffic .. thats all ..
